Cocaine intoxication

Cocaine intoxication I. Problem/Condition. Cocaine abuse and dependence are epidemic in the US. In 2007, over 2 million Americans had recent cocaine use; 1.6 million met criteria for cocaine dependence or abuse. Alcohol toxicity

Alcohol toxicity or poisoning is caused by drinking large quantities of alcohol in a short period of time. According to Centers for Disease Control (CDC) data released January 2015, an average of 6 people died of alcohol poisoning each day in the US from 2010-2012.
